Function Inspection
Press Storage Default to restore the oscilloscope to its factory states.
1.
2.
Connect the ground alligator clip of the probe to the "Ground Terminal" as
shown in the figure below.
3.
Use the probe to connect the input terminal of CH1 of the oscilloscope and the
"Probe Compensation Signal Output Terminal".
Figure 1-7 Probe Compensation Signal Output Terminal/Ground Terminal
Set the attenuation on the probe to 10X. Then press AUTO.
4.
5.
Observe the waveform on the display. If the waveforms actually shown do not
match that in the figure below, please perform "Probe Compensation".
6.
Use the same method to test the other channels.
WARNING
To avoid electric shock during the use of probe, please make sure that the
insulated wire of the probe is in good condition. Do not touch the metallic
part of the probe when the probe is connected to high voltage source.
